Storm surge is an abnormal rise in sea level caused by the wind and pressure associated with a storm, particularly hurricanes and tropical storms. As these storms approach shorelines, strong winds push seawater toward the coast, resulting in elevated water levels that can inundate coastal areas. This sudden surge of water can lead to devastating flooding, erosion, and destruction of infrastructure, making it one of the most dangerous aspects of severe storms. Additionally, the height and impact of storm surges can be exacerbated by factors like coastal topography and the timing of the surge relative to high tide.

How much damage does a 56 mph hurricane do?

A storm with 56 mph winds would not be a hurricane; it would be a moderate tropical storm. Winds must be at least 74 mph for a storm to be a hurricane. A tropical storm with such winds may break some tree limbs and down a few trees. Some very weak structures may be damaged. The rain from such a storm could cause significant flooding. How much would be difficult to predict as flooding risk does not depend on wind speed.

What is a storm shurge and why does it cause so much damage?

The storm surge is a bulge on the ocean surface created by a hurricane's winds. When a hurricane makes landfall it essentially brings the ocean on shore. In addition to causing normal water damage, which can be seen in normal flooding, the water in a storm surge carries a tremendous amount of force that, in some of the stronger hurricanes, can wash away buildings.
